INTELLI PUSHER THE PUSHER HAS A ADJUSTMENT SCREW FOR ADJUSTING DISTANCE TO SENSE TRAVEL. THE PUSHER IS PRESET TO APPROXIMATELY 3/4″ to 3”.

PADDLE OPERATION THE PUSHER WILL SIGNAL (BEEP) ONCE EVERY TIME THE PADDLE IS SLIDE FORWARD BY THE SELECTED DISTANCE UP TO 4 TIME IN A 10 SECOND PERIOD PADDLE WILL ALARM FOR 5SEC. IF THE PADDLE SLIDE MORE THAN 4X THE PRESET DISTANCE IN SINGLE MOTION, THE PADDLE WILL SEND A SILENT RF SIGNAL TO THE ECHO BOX RECIEVER TO ALARM FOR 5 SEC. NOTE THE DISTANCE CAN BE CHANGED WITH THE ADJUSTMENT SCREW. THE PADDLE IS INOPERATIVE WHEN PUSHED BACK FOR STOCKING TO PREVENT FALSE ALARMS. THE LED LIGHT WILL BLINK EVERY TIME THE PUSHER BEEPS OR ALARM.

OPERATION MODES FOR THE R- SONR-RECXA AND R-SONR REC AUDIO BEEP AND ALARM “A” MODE THE RECEIVER’S AUDIO IN “A” MODE WILL MIMIC THEPUSHER BEEP AND ALARM. THE OUTPUTTERMINALS WILL ALSO ACTIVATE WHEN IN THE ALARM SEQUENCE. THE RESET BUTTON WILL TURN THE ALARM OFF ON THE RECEIVER ONLY. THE PUSHER WILLCONTINUE TO ALARM FOR 5 SECONDS. “B” MODE THE RECEIVER AUDIO IN “B” MODE WILL ONLY MIMIC THE PUSHERBEEPS WITH NO ALARM SEQUENCE ATTHE RECEIVER. AUXILIARY PORTS WILLSTILL ACTIVATE WHEN RECEIVING AN ALARM SIGNAL FROM THE PUSHER ALARM.

R-SONR-REC-XA RECEIVER WILL ONLY ALARM AND BEEP.

R-SONR-REC-PXA RECEIVER WILL ALARM AND BEEP AND SEND SIGNALS TO THE AUXILLARY TERMINALS.
